Fermer

septembre 26, 2020

Interface utilisateur Telerik pour WinForms R3 2020: TaskDialog, prise en charge de .NET 5


Bienvenue dans R3 2020 pour l'interface utilisateur Telerik pour WinForms! Pour notre dernière version pour 2020, nous avons préparé de nouvelles fonctionnalités intéressantes, y compris un tout nouveau contrôle TaskDialog, la prise en charge au moment de la conception pour .NET 5, la prise en charge des images vectorielles pour Fluent Theme, le dimensionnement automatique des colonnes pour ListView et plus encore!

Nous sommes ravis d'annoncer que la toute nouvelle interface utilisateur Telerik pour WinForms R3 2020 est officiellement là! Tout d'abord, la prise en charge de .NET 5.0 Designer pour la suite Telerik UI pour WinForms est désormais disponible! La suite a des ajouts sous la forme de RadTaskDialog un nouveau AutoSizeColumnMode pour RadListView des images SVG pour FluentTheme la population de la ToolBox de VisualStudio avec les contrôles Telerik après l'installation de Package NuGet prise en charge du format XLS dans RadSpreadProcessing prise en charge des tables CMap dans RadPdfProcessing et bien d'autres améliorations basées sur vos retours!

Explorons un peu plus en profondeur.

Support de WinForms Designer .NET 5.0

Vous pourrez faire glisser et déposer tous les contrôles Telerik directement dans votre formulaire en utilisant l'environnement .NET 5.0. L'accès aux balises actives et aux autres fonctionnalités de Design Time sera disponible. Tout ce que vous avez à faire est d'installer le dernier Visual Studio 2019 Preview (version 16.8 Preview 3 ou plus récent), .NET 5.0 et bien sûr l'interface utilisateur Telerik pour les packages NuGet WinForms ou le dernier MSI.

 Telerik UI pour WinForms NET 5 WinForms Designer Support "title =" Telerik UI pour WinForms NET 5 WinForms Designer Support "/></p data-recalc-dims=

Brand New RadTaskDialog

RadTaskDialog est une alternative thématique de Windows ] et le nouveau TaskDialog for .NET 5. La boîte de dialogue est une fenêtre qui permet aux utilisateurs d'exécuter une commande, de poser une question aux utilisateurs, de fournir des informations aux utilisateurs ou d'indiquer la progression d'une tâche en cours. RadTaskDialog représente une version étendue de System.Windows.Forms.MessageBox standard et respectivement de la RadMessageBox . Par rapport à une boîte de message standard, peut afficher des contrôles supplémentaires comme une barre de progression et prend en charge la gestion des événements. Maintenant, ce contrôle est intégré dans l'interface utilisateur Telerik pour la suite WinForms.

 Interface utilisateur Telerik pour WinForms Nouveau RadTaskDialog "title =" Interface utilisateur Telerik pour WinForms Nouveau RadTaskDialog "/></p data-recalc-dims=

Voici quelques-unes des principales fonctionnalités:

  • Taille automatique : La taille de la fenêtre est basée sur le contenu ajouté à la page.

  • Paging : permet de naviguer vers une nouvelle page (en reconstruisant la boîte de dialogue à partir des propriétés actuelles). La boîte de dialogue de tâche peut agir comme un petit assistant avec plusieurs pages. Microsoft recommande de ne pas utiliser plus de trois pages.

  • Éléments pris en charge : prend en charge tous les éléments natifs de la boîte de dialogue des tâches (comme les boutons personnalisés, les liens de commande, la barre de progression, les boutons radio, la case à cocher, la zone développée, le pied de page). La boîte de dialogue des tâches prend en charge un large éventail d'éléments prédéfinis qui peuvent être affectés à la page et seront automatiquement organisés sans avoir besoin d'écrire de logique de mise en page.

  • Icônes : En plus des icônes standard qui indiquent Erreur, Avertissement, Information, la boîte de dialogue de tâche comporte une barre verte, jaune, rouge, grise ou bleue sur tout l'arrière-plan du titre / titre. De plus, les icônes et images personnalisées sont également prises en charge dès la sortie de la boîte.

  • Modal vs Non-Modal : Peut être affiché modal ou non-modal, via le ShowDialog ou les méthodes Show.

  • Localisation : Localisation pour chacune des chaînes prédéfinies.

  • Prise en charge de droite à gauche

  • Thème

  • Personnalisation : Microsoft TaskDialog encapsule la fenêtre native et les composants natifs, qui ne fournissent pas d'options de personnalisation. RadTaskDialog peut être construit selon les exigences spécifiques que vous devez couvrir.

AutoSizeColumnMode pour ListView

RadListView offre désormais un excellent moyen de modifier automatiquement la largeur des colonnes, vous permettant de remplir l'espace disponible dans le contrôle. Tout ce que vous avez à faire est de définir la propriété AutoSizeColumnMode sur Fill .

 Exemple montrant l'interface utilisateur Telerik pour WinForms AutoSizeColumnMode pour ListView espaçant efficacement les largeurs de colonne

Thème Fluent chargé d'images SVG

Le thème Fluent est livré avec des images vectorielles intégrées. Ces images SVG sont également modernisées pour que le thème réponde aux dernières tendances.

 Interface utilisateur Telerik pour WinForms Fluent Theme Images SVG Premier exemple

 Telerik UI pour WinForms Fluent Theme Images SVG Deuxième exemple

Design Time Disponible avec l'installation de la dernière version NuGet

La boîte à outils de Visual Studio est remplie avec le Telerik UI pour les contrôles WinForms après l'installation du dernier package NuGet. Vous pouvez personnaliser librement vos applications au moment du design.

Créer de nouveaux modèles de projet désormais disponibles pour .NET Core 3.1 et .NET 5.0

Lorsque vous créez un nouveau projet WinForms pour .NET 3.1 ou .NET 5.0, vous pouvez choisir l'un des modèles prédéfinis.

Options de distribution .NET Core

Lorsque vous créez un nouveau projet WinForms pour .NET Core 3.1, vous pouvez choisir d'avoir vos distributions sous forme d'assemblages Telerik WinForms ou de références de package Telerik.

 Interface utilisateur Telerik pour WinForms NET Core Distribution Options "title =" Telerik UI pour WinForms NET Core Distribution Options "/></p data-recalc-dims=

Améliorations de Control Suite

Sur la base de vos commentaires, nous avons apporté plus de 45 améliorations avec la version actuelle. la suite.

RadSpreadProcessing: Prise en charge du format XLS

Créez et modifiez des documents XLS en code-behind avec le nouveau XlsFormatProvider . La nouvelle classe vous permet d'importer et d'exporter des documents d'Excel 97 – Excel 2003 Format de fichier binaire.

RadPdfProcessing: Prise en charge des tableaux CMap

Les tableaux CMap des documents PDF définissent les mappages entre les codes de caractères et les sélecteurs de caractères. Vous pouvez désormais importer de manière transparente des documents contenant les tableaux CMap prédéfinis au format PDF et ceux personnalisés sont importés comme prévu. Pour savoir comment les activer dans la rubrique d'aide CMap Tables .

Inscription au webinaire

Pour voir la nouvelle version en action, rejoignez-nous sur le webinaire Telerik R3 2020 le jeudi 1er octobre de 23 h 00 à 12 h 00 HE.

Save My Seat

Essayez la dernière contribution

Téléchargez la dernière version de Telerik UI pour WinForms essayez-la et partagez vos impressions sur notre portail de commentaires ou en laissant un commentaires ci-dessous. Nous aimerions savoir comment tout cela fonctionne pour vous.





Source link